About Gerald Rimbach

Gerald Rimbach is a scholar working on Molecular Biology, Biochemistry, Nutrition and Dietetics, Physiology and Plant Science, having authored 362 papers that have together received 17.4k indexed citations. Recurring topics across this work include Antioxidant Activity and Oxidative Stress (68 papers), Phytochemicals and Antioxidant Activities (41 papers), Genomics, phytochemicals, and oxidative stress (37 papers), Free Radicals and Antioxidants (24 papers), Vitamin C and Antioxidants Research (22 papers), Adipose Tissue and Metabolism (21 papers), Phytoestrogen effects and research (20 papers) and Phytase and its Applications (19 papers). The work is most often cited by research in Biochemistry (3.6k citations), Aging (390 citations), Molecular Medicine (860 citations), Nutrition and Dietetics (2.4k citations) and Complementary and alternative medicine (1.1k citations). Gerald Rimbach has collaborated with scholars based in Germany, United Kingdom and United States. Frequent co-authors include Anika E. Wagner, Patricia Huebbe, Lester Packer, Tuba Esatbeyoglu, Anne Marie Minihane, Siegfried Wolffram, Christine Boesch‐Saadatmandi, J. Pallauf, Jan Frank and Sarah Egert. Their work appears in journals such as Molecular Nutrition & Food Research, Nutrients, British Journal Of Nutrition, BioFactors and International Journal of Molecular Sciences.
